Experimental Political Science and the Study of Causality Morton Williams
“Experimental Political Science and the Study of Causality” by Rebecca B. Morton and Kenneth C. Williams is a textbook published by Cambridge University Press in 2010. This book explores the subject area of Political Science through the lens of experimental research, focusing on the study of causality. With a total of 608 pages, this trade paperback is a valuable resource for those interested in understanding the methods and theories used in experimental political science.
